Standard Chartered JumpStart offering up to 2.5% p.a. interest. Best for students?
By Beansprout  •  March 5, 2023
TL;DR
  • The Standard Chartered (SC) JumpStart Account is a no-frills savings account offering an interest rate of 2.00% p.a. for the first $50,000 of deposits. You will earn an extra 0.50% p.a. step-up interest if you invest.
  • There are few requirements to earn the interest rate of 2.00% p.a. on the first $50,000. You will earn an interest of 0.10% p.a. for deposits above S$50,000.
  • The SC JumpStart Account offers the highest interest rates for deposits of up to $50,000 amongst entry-level savings accounts in Singapore.
  • To open an account, you need to be aged between 18 to 26 years old. Existing account holders that are over 26 years of age can still retain the SC JumpStart Account.
What happened? Standard Chartered (SC) JumpStart is now offering an interest rate of up to 2.5% p.a. for the first S$50,000 of deposits. The maximum amount of deposits to earn the interest rate of up to 2.5% p.a. has been raised from S$20,000 previously....
